Middletown Man Missing; May Be Near Natco Lake
A dive team was called in as police combed the area around Natco Lake Sunday looking for John Fernandez, 22.

Middletown, NJ - A 22-year-old Middletown man is missing, according to township police. A massive manhunt took place Sunday in the area around Natco Lake to try and find John Fernandez, 22, but there was no sign of him, police said.
Fernandez was last seen at 1:30 a.m. on Sunday, December 13 at his home on Kentucky Avenue in Middletown. He may be in the Natco Lake/Hazlet area or along Henry Hudson Trail, police said.
Middletown and Hazlet police combed the area around Natco Lake Sunday looking for him, Hazlet police said. Divers were called in from the Monmouth County Sheriff’s Office Underwater Search team to search the waters of Natco Lake. Police K9 dogs were used; Hazlet’s ATV units and the sheriff’s department helicopter combed the wooded area, but no sign of Fernandez was found.

Fernandez is described as a Filipino male, 5’10 with a thin build, and black hair. He may be wearing a dark grey leather jacket with a gray fabric hood and black high top “Heely” sneakers with wheels similar to a roller skate. According to his Facebook page, he studies accounting a Seton Hall University.
Anyone with information is asked to call Detective Kelly Godley of the Middletown Police Department at (732) 615-2120. Photo used with permission from Middletown Police.
